Find a vector parametrization r(t) for the line with the given description. Passes through P = (5, 0, 3), direction vector v = 3, 0, 5

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that a line passes through a point

P = (5, 0, 3)

Direction vector = [tex]v = 3, 0, 5[/tex]

Let (x,y,z) =r(t) be any general point on the line

We have

[tex]x-5, y-0, z-3[/tex] will be proportional to v

Or [tex]\frac{x-5}{3} =\frac{y}{0} =\frac{z-3}{5}[/tex]

Let this equals t

Then parametric form

= [tex]r(t) = (5+3t)i +0.j+(3+5t)k[/tex]
